Constructs.filter_by_ncvar(*ncvars)[source]¶ Select domain axis constructs by netCDF variable name.
New in version 1.7.0.

- ncvars: optional
Select constructs that have any of the given netCDF variable names.
A netCDF variable name is specified by a string (e.g.
'time'); or a compiled regular expression (e.g.re.compile('^lat')), for which all constructs whose netCDF variable names match (viare.search) are selected.If no netCDF variable names are provided then all constructs that do or could have a netCDF variable name, with any value, are selected.
- Returns
ConstructsThe selected constructs and their construct keys.
Examples:
Select the constructs with netCDF variable name ‘time’:
>>> d = c.filter_by_ncvar('time')
Select the constructs with netCDF variable name ‘time’ or ‘lat’:
>>> d = c.filter_by_ncvar('time', 'lat')
